How to Know the Best Comfort Riding Tires
Driving for long distances can be quite boring. You keep passing the same things. If passengers feel the bumps, potholes, slips through the water, and the noise emanating from the tires, the journey becomes more troublesome. It is important to ensure personal and passenger wellbeing by purchasing comfort tires. Besides, they improve the experience.
However, there are several considerations before deciding to purchase. These include:
- Know and understand your car
Manufacturers know that every tire requires a replacement after a period of use. Therefore, they insert instructions and recommendations for new tires with other car documentation. Go through these for more information on your car. The manual or guide has pertinent information and details to help you make the right decision.
- Material and size of the tire you need
Vehicles that are too low end up hitting stones, bumps, and potholes while on the road. Thus, they keep producing noise that is discomfiting. Simultaneously, less material (rubber) has a similar effect as the treads are smaller. Releasing air or absorbing vibrations becomes difficult.
Purchase a slightly larger tire with more of the foundation material. Deeper treads of different patterns absorb vibrations and keep the noise to a minimum. Treads are soft, and with ample balance and traction, you feel comfortable through the ride.
- Ability to clean
In the past, tires slip and lost traction due to mud sticking and keeping a hold on the tire. In recent times, companies have sought out self-cleaning mechanisms to remedy the case. All-purpose or the four-season tires scoop the mud, but when they start to roll forward, they release. The same process applies to water pools on the road.
The feature is a self-cleaning method. It keeps the tire performance at par with high hold and grip (traction). Plus, cleaning the vehicle becomes easier and faster.
- Load indexes and Speed Rating
Every tire brand comes with a maximum load it can carry while maintaining its high performance. The load index gives indications to maintain balance and stability while on the move.
The speed rating is an assessment of the speed you can garner while driving at certain conditions. The purpose is to prevent consistent tread wear and heating. It helps maintain the highest rate without risking your safety.
- Weather
The current weather condition of your living area determines tire type and comfort while driving. Consistent weather during the summer offers security in purchasing a comfortable tire.
However, that same tire is not useful during winter when the temperatures drop each minute. Each tire design matches a specific condition even though some manufacturers have all-purpose tires. They work through the four seasons of the year.

How do the treads on the tire affect noise production while driving?
The design and shape of the tread determine the noise the tire produces. Blocks in the same form make a sharp but whiny sound. However, a combination allows the air to come in and flow out without creating noise. Therefore, choose tires with combined shapes in the treads for the quietness on the road.
